Within the rich tapestry of Shia Islam, the text “Al-Wafi” holds a distinguished place, revered not only for its scholarly depth but also for its profound elucidation of the theological tenets central to the Shia faith. This treatise, which intricately weaves together traditional Islamic narratives, offers a holistic perspective that catalyzes a transformative understanding of both the religious and social dimensions of Shia beliefs.
At its core, “Al-Wafi” serves as a compendium of teachings, drawing from the extensive repository of Hadith literature. The book meticulously compiles and elucidates the sayings and actions of the revered Imams, particularly emphasizing their role as exemplars of virtue and piety. Unlike mere historical chronicles, the teachings within “Al-Wafi” illuminate the ethical and moral paradigms that govern the lives of Shia adherents. These narratives are not merely anecdotal; they are imbued with profound lessons that encourage introspection and foster a virtuous lifestyle.
A striking feature of “Al-Wafi” is its emphasis on the concept of Imamate. This central tenet of Shia doctrine posits that the Imams, as divinely appointed leaders, embody the ultimate moral compass for the Muslim community. Their unparalleled wisdom and spiritual guidance serve as a beacon for navigating the complexities of life. The book compels the reader to reconsider their understanding of leadership, shifting the perspective from mere political authority to a more encompassing model of ethical and spiritual guardianship.
Central to the teachings of “Al-Wafi” is the exploration of justice (‘Adalat) as a divine attribute, deeply rooted in the Shia conception of God. The text artfully dissects the notion that divine justice is not merely retributive but also restorative. This nuanced understanding translates into the Shia articulation of social justice, urging adherents to advocate for equity and fairness within their communities. “Al-Wafi” challenges readers to cultivate a commitment to social justice, transforming theological principles into actionable items that resonate within the fabric of daily life.
